WebMar 4, 2024 · Rothera Point has been home to the BAS research station since 1975 and is the largest British research facility in Antarctica. It houses approximately 140 people, from staff scientists to the construction workers that are currently expanding the wharf. Rothera Research Station is the BAS logistics centre for the Antarctic and home of well-equipped biological laboratories and facilities for a wide range of research. The station is situated on a rock and raised beach promontory at the southern extremity of Wormald Ice Piedmont, south-eastern Adelaide Island.
